SAN JOAQUIN COUNTY <br /> ENVIRONMENTAL HEALTH DEPARTMENT <br /> 600 East Main Street, Stockton, California 95202-3029 <br /> Telephone: (209)468-3420 Fax: (209) 468-3433 Web:www.sigov.org/ehd/unitiii.html <br /> CONTINUATION FORM Page: 4 of 4 <br /> OFFICIAL INSPECTION REPORT Date: 10/25/11 <br /> Facility Address: 1137 Lathrop Road, Manteca Program: UST <br /> SUMMARY OF VIOLATIONS <br /> CLASS I, CLASS II, or MINOR-Notice to Comply) <br /> 403. During the record review following observation was made on the 87 STP sump: <br /> 10/7/11 - 45 gallons of liquid was found and removed by Walton Engineering, <br /> 6/8/11 - 55 gallons of water was found and removed by LC Services, <br /> 4/7/11 - 90 gallons of water was found and removed by LC Services, <br /> 3/22/11 - 80 gallons of water was found and removed by LC Services, <br /> 2/25/11 - 180 gallons of water was removed from the 87 STP and Fill sump by LC Services, <br /> 11/9/10 - 35 gallons of liquid was found and removed by Walton Engineering. <br /> Today 7.5 gallons of liquid was found in the 87 fill sump, 4 oz of liquid was found in 91 fill sump, Diesel <br /> STP sump and the 7/8 Dispenser UDC indicating a leak in the secondary containment. Secondary <br /> containment shall be impervious to the liquid and vapor of the substance contained and constructed to <br /> prevent structural weakening as a result of contact with any hazardous substances released from the <br /> primary containment. Immediately contact a properly licensed, trained, and certified contractor to make <br /> repairs to the UST system under permit and inspection of the EHD. The technician removed all liquid <br /> and put it in the facility's hazardous waste drum. <br /> 406. The Diesel STP double wall Sump sensor and the Diesel fill sump liquid sensor failed when tested <br /> for functionality. The sensors monitoring the liquid level in the interstitial space shall be maintained so <br /> that a breach in the primary or secondary containment is detected before the hazardous substance is <br /> released into the environment. Correct immediately by having a properly licensed, trained, and certified <br /> contractor replace the failed component with a functional component (LG 113-x listed, if applicable) and <br /> obtain a permit within one business day from the EHD. The failed sensor was replace, retested and <br /> passed (Model 794390-304).
